Grilled Drunken Cilantro & Lime Shrimp
Course appetizers, Entree, Main
Prep Time 10 Minutes
Cook Time 4-8 Minutes
Servings
Servings
Ingredients
  • 2 Pounds fresh gulf shrimp peeled
  • 1 Cup fresh cilantro chopped
  • 1/2 Cup tequila
  • 1 Medium lime juice
  • 1 T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 Te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 Teaspoon kosher salt
  • 1/2 Teaspoon ground black pepper

Instructions
  1. In a large bowl, combine tequila, cilantro, lime, olive oil, onion powder, salt and pepper. Whisk together until well combined. Pour a 1/4 cup of the mixture into a small bowl and set aside. Add fresh peeled shrimp into the large bowl mixture and gently toss together until well coated. Place into the refrigerator for 30 minutes to marinate.
  2. After 30 minutes, heat the grill to a medium high temperature. Skewer the shrimp (depending on the size, if needed) and place onto the grill for 2-4 minutes or until the first side has turned pink and slightly golden. Flip skewers over and cook the other side for another 2-4 minutes or until shrimp is pink and that side is slightly golden. Remove from the grill and either brush or toss the shrimp with the remaining sauce then serve.
